The Opportunity

At UserTesting, we’re the leader in human insight, helping organizations build better products and experiences by connecting them with real human perspectives. As companies increasingly build and train AI systems, our technology, participant network, and expert services uniquely position us to support this rapidly evolving space.

AI Training is a new business being incubated within UserTesting, focused on applying our expertise in sourcing and managing specialized communities to power high-quality AI training initiatives. As one of the early members of this team, you’ll have the opportunity to shape how we operate, build scalable processes from the ground up, and play a key role in growing a new business.

We’re looking for a Strategic Projects Lead to own the end-to-end delivery of AI training projects—from early customer conversations through successful execution. You’ll partner with customers, internal stakeholders, and contributor communities to solve complex operational challenges, delivering high-quality outcomes while building repeatable systems that enable future growth.

Responsibilities

  • Own the end-to-end delivery of AI training projects, partnering with customers from initial scoping through successful execution while assessing feasibility, timelines, operational requirements, pricing inputs, and project risks.

  • Develop and execute sourcing strategies for specialized contributor populations by leveraging UserTesting’s network, external recruiting channels, partner partnerships, and other creative approaches to meet customer needs.

  • Recruit, onboard, and manage contributor communities, designing scalable operational workflows that include onboarding, task distribution, contributor communications, quality assurance, escalations, and delivery.

  • Monitor project performance by tracking key operational metrics—including recruiting progress, activation, throughput, quality, cost, and retention—and proactively adjust plans to ensure successful outcomes.

  • Own project economics by balancing sourcing strategies, contributor compensation, staffing, quality expectations, and delivery timelines to drive efficient execution.

  • Serve as the primary customer contact throughout project delivery, translating evolving requirements into clear guidance for contributors while communicating progress, risks, and tradeoffs with transparency.

  • Continuously improve how the team operates by identifying opportunities to build repeatable processes, scalable systems, and operational capabilities that support the long-term growth of the AI Training business.

Requirements

  • 4+ years of experience leading complex, cross-functional projects in operations, strategic programs, consulting, AI training, marketplaces, expert networks, talent platforms, data operations, or similar fast-paced environments.

  • Proven experience managing projects involving large populations of contractors, contributors, participants, experts, or other external workforces. Experience in AI training or human data organizations is strongly preferred.

  • Strong project management and analytical skills, with the ability to manage multiple priorities, model project performance, monitor operational metrics, and understand project economics.

  • Demonstrated ownership and problem-solving skills, with the ability to thrive in ambiguity, build processes from the ground up, and balance detailed execution with strategic thinking.

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with experience partnering directly with customers and collaborating across cross-functional teams.

  • Familiarity with AI training concepts such as annotation, evaluations, quality assurance, reinforcement learning environments, expert data, or post-training workflows is preferred.

  • Location: Remote within the United States, with the ability to work primarily within U.S. time zones.

What you need to know about the Charlotte Tech Scene

Ranked among the hottest tech cities in 2024 by CompTIA, Charlotte is quickly cementing its place as a major U.S. tech hub. Home to more than 90,000 tech workers, the city’s ecosystem is primed for continued growth, fueled by billions in annual funding from heavyweights like Microsoft and RevTech Labs, which has created thousands of fintech jobs and made the city a go-to for tech pros looking for their next big opportunity.

Key Facts About Charlotte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 90,859; 6.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lowe’s, Bank of America, TIAA, Microsoft, Honeywell
  • Key Industries: Fintech,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, cloud computing, e-commerce
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(CED)
  • Notable Investors: Microsoft, Google, Falfurrias Management Partners, RevTech Labs Foundation
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Northeastern University, North Carolina Research Campus
